Within these twelve essays, Kemp describes and analyzes nineteenth century improvements in building materials such as iron, steel, and cement, roads and bridges, especially the evolution of the suspension bridge, canals and navigable rivers, including the Ohio River and its tributaries, and water supply systems.

Few know the name Anna Jarvis, yet on the second Sunday in May, we mail the card, buy the flowers, place the phone call, or make the brunch reservation to honor our mothers, all because of her. Anna Jarvis organized the first official Mother's Day celebration in Grafton, West Virginia in 1908 and then spent decades promoting the holiday and defending it from commercialization. Transnational West Virginia includes essays and studies on immigrant networks, such as Irish workers along the B&O, Railroad, Wheeling Germans in the Civil War era, Swiss immigration to West Virginia, and European Jews in Southern West Virginia.
